Understanding Marketing Efficiency Ratio (MER)

Marketing efficiency ratio (MER) is the measure of how much revenue is generated from each marketing dollar invested in your WooCommerce store. It's the percentage of revenue generated per dollar spent on marketing. A high MER indicates that your marketing strategies are effective in generating revenue, while a low MER means that your marketing efforts are not generating the desired results.

What is Marketing Efficiency Ratio (MER)?

MER is a critical metric because it helps you understand the effectiveness of your marketing campaigns, identify areas for improvement, and make data-driven decisions to optimize your marketing strategies.

For example, let's say you invest $100 in a Facebook advertising campaign, and it generates $500 in revenue. Your MER for that campaign would be 500%, which is calculated by dividing the revenue generated ($500) by the marketing dollars invested ($100) and multiplying by 100.

By tracking your MER for each marketing campaign, you can identify which campaigns are generating the highest return on investment (ROI) and adjust your marketing budget accordingly. This will help you maximize your revenue and minimize your marketing expenses.

Why is MER important for your WooCommerce store?

MER is essential because it helps you identify which marketing campaigns are generating the most revenue for your WooCommerce store. Knowing this information will enable you to allocate your marketing budget more effectively, invest more in successful campaigns, and reduce spending on less effective campaigns.

For example, if you have two marketing campaigns running simultaneously, and one has an MER of 500% while the other has an MER of 200%, you know that the first campaign is generating more revenue per dollar spent. You can then allocate more of your marketing budget to that campaign to maximize your revenue.

Additionally, tracking your MER over time can help you identify trends in your marketing performance. For example, if you notice that your MER is consistently decreasing over time, it may be a sign that your marketing strategies need to be adjusted to better align with your target audience.

Setting up WooCommerce for MER calculation

Before you can calculate your MER, you must set up your WooCommerce store correctly. Here's how:

Installing necessary plugins and tools

One of the best ways to calculate your MER accurately is to use an analytics tool like Google Analytics. This will help you track important data about your website visitors, including where they are coming from, what pages they are visiting, and what actions they are taking on your site. With this information, you can make informed decisions about how to improve your website and increase sales.

In addition to Google Analytics, there are several plugins and tools you can use to integrate analytics with your store and track your campaigns' performance effectively. For example, the WooCommerce Google Analytics Integration plugin allows you to easily connect your store to Google Analytics and track important ecommerce metrics like revenue, conversion rate, and average order value.

Another popular analytics plugin is MonsterInsights, which provides detailed insights into your website traffic and ecommerce performance. With MonsterInsights, you can track important metrics like product views, add to carts, and purchases, as well as see which marketing channels are driving the most traffic and sales to your store.

Gathering data for MER calculation

Before you can calculate your MER, you must collect specific data related to your marketing campaigns.

Identifying relevant marketing costs

The first step is to identify all the costs associated with your marketing campaigns. This includes advertising costs, content creation costs, affiliate commission costs, and any other expenses related to promoting your products or services.

Tracking revenue generated from marketing efforts

Next, you need to track the revenue generated from each marketing campaign. This includes revenue from new customers and repeat customers who made purchases through your marketing campaigns.

Monitoring customer acquisition and retention metrics

It's also essential to track customer acquisition and retention metrics to calculate your MER accurately. This includes tracking the number of new customers acquired through each campaign and the percentage of existing customers that were retained.

Calculating Marketing Efficiency Ratio (MER)

Once you have collected all the relevant data, you can start calculating your MER.

Step-by-step guide to calculating MER

The formula for calculating MER is simple:

  1. Divide the revenue generated from a marketing campaign by the total cost of the campaign
  2. Multiply the result by 100 to get the MER in percentage

For example, if a campaign generated $10,000 in revenue and cost $2,000, the MER is:

  1. $10,000 / $2,000 = 5
  2. 5 x 100 = 500%

Interpreting your MER results

An MER of more than 100% indicates that your marketing campaign generated more revenue than it cost. In contrast, an MER of less than 100% means your campaign cost more than the revenue it generated. It's essential to compare your MER with industry benchmarks and your previous campaigns' results to make informed decisions.

Tips for improving your WooCommerce store's MER

Now that you know how to calculate your MER, you can take steps to improve it. Here are some tips:

Optimizing marketing campaigns

Identify the campaigns with the highest and lowest MERs and optimize them accordingly. You can adjust your targeting, messaging, or visuals to improve your campaigns' performance.

Enhancing customer experience and retention

Improving the customer experience and retention rate will help increase your revenue and lower your marketing costs. Focus on providing excellent customer service, offering loyalty programs, and upselling and cross-selling to increase your revenue per customer.

Utilizing data-driven decision-making

Use data to make informed decisions and adjust your marketing strategies accordingly. Test different tactics and measure results to find what works best for your WooCommerce store.
